Compact sleeping box offers alternative to spare rooms
AFBytes Brief
A compact sleeping unit is being marketed as a practical substitute for dedicated guest rooms in smaller homes.
Why this matters
Space-efficient housing products may ease living costs for urban renters facing high square-footage prices.
